If Tomorrow Should Start Without Me



When the sun has set for me:
Why cry for a soul set free?
For this is the path that I should take,
It’s not my decision I had to make.

I wish you didn’t cry like you did today,
I am always in your heart even though I’m far away.
For this is my road that had to end,
for it is today that the Lord, His angel did send.

Wherever our ocean meets our sky,
remember the memories of you and I.
Today, without me is a new start,
but I forever leave my footprints in your heart.
